Police have laid charges over offending allegedly involving a group of young people on Auckland’s North Shore in the past month.
Operation Jacaranda began as an investigation into an aggravated robbery in Takapuna on 22 August and has since identified further offences.
Inspector Aron McKeown, Waitematā East Area Commander says a dedicated team of detectives have undertaken a complex investigation involving multiple victims, several suspects, and extensive enquiries.
Police are appealing to the public for sightings of Sahana, reported missing from Wellington.
Sahana was last seen boarding the number 14 bus from Cecil Road, Wadestown on Tuesday 15 September.
It is believed she might be in the Lambton Quay or Courtney Place area, but enquiries so far haven’t located her.
Sahana was last wearing blue jeans, grey hoodie and a black puffer jacket, is of slight build and 167cm tall.
Police and her family have concerns for her welfare and would like to see her return home.
